Cambridge GaN Devices raises $32 million to expand power semiconductor production

  • Cambridge GaN Devices (CGD) has raised $32 million in Series C funding to expand its power semiconductor production.
  • The investment was led by a strategic investor and included participation from British Patient Capital and existing investors.
  • CGD develops energy-efficient power semiconductors using gallium nitride (GaN) for electric vehicles and data centers.
  • The company's ICeGaN technology enables energy savings of up to 50% in high-power applications.
